Output abb78868f9a115427b53344e0747adeaaf6d3e89d45b0987b6b1fee38b63cfe2:1

value
106942308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ede5cf972dbfb16f940581276a35331d9aa230 OP_EQUAL
address
3CFzd2UDFpq2W7oxo2CYJvsvKPxea6sz39
transaction
abb78868f9a115427b53344e0747adeaaf6d3e89d45b0987b6b1fee38b63cfe2
spent
true